  • 三级生物质供应链的奖惩与回馈契约协调研究

    为了优化生物质能供应链,降低成本,在无扰动因素情况,需求不确定且与价格有关的条件下,研究了由能源公司、基地和农户组成的三级生物质供应链中,奖惩与回馈契约对供应链的协调问题,建立了满足渠道协调的条件和供应链内各级参与者实现互赢的数学模型,最后将其用于数值算例中验证.结果证明契约参数的合理选择可以实现供应链各方利益最大.

  • For planning optimum multiple stresses accelerated life test plans, a commonly followed guiding principle is that all parameters of the life-stress relationship should be estimated, and the number of the stress level combinations must be no less than the number of parameters of the life-stress relationship. However, the general objective of an accelerated life test(ALT) is to assess the p-th quantile of the product life distribution under normal stress. For this objective, estimating all model parameters is not necessary, and this will increase the cost of test. Based on the theoretical conclusion that the stress level combinations of the optimum multiple stresses ALT plan locate on a straight line through the origin of coordinate, it is proposed that a design idea of planning the optimum multiple stresses ALT plan through transforming the problem of designing an optimum multiple stresses ALT plan to designing an optimum single stress ALT plan. Moreover, a method of planning the optimum multiple stresses ALT plan which can avoid estimating all model parameters is established. An example shows that, the proposed plan which only has two stress level combinations could achieve an accuracy no less than the traditional plan, and save the test time and cost on one stress level combination at least; when the actual product life is less than the design value, even the deviation of the model initial parameters value is up to 20%, the variance of the estimation of the p-th quantile of the proposed plan is still smaller than the traditional plans approximately 25%. A design method is provided for planning the optimum multiple stresses ALT which uses the statistical optimum degenerate test plan as the optimum multiple stresses accelerated life test plan.

  • 木桩拦栅筑堤土围堰技术在大汕子工程中的应用

    运用瑞典圆弧滑动法对围堰布置及结构形式进行了验算,阐释了施工方法和施工过程.通过实践表明工程实施中采用木桩拦栅围挡、就近水中取土筑施工围堰,能有效地解决了土源问题,节约工程造价,缩短工程工期.木桩拦栅筑堤土围堰技术方案在浅滩、湖泊、内河等水面宽阔、水深在2~4m的地域推广运用,能取得明显的社会和经济效益.

  • CAE技术在注塑模冷却水道优化设计中的应用

    注塑模设计过程中,冷却水道布局的好坏,关系到塑件的成型质量和成型周期.以某深腔塑件为例,阐述了CAE技术在注塑模冷却水道优化设计中的应用方法和意义.

  • 浅谈桃林口小坝加固及引青西线改造工程

    针对桃林口小坝及引青西线工程因受当时设计、施工条件限制存在诸多问题的现状,为保证引青济秦工程的安全运行,保障秦皇岛市用水安全,实施桃林口小坝加固及引青西线改造工程.分析了原有工程存在的具体问题,提出改造工程设计方案,通过经济评价,工程在经济上合理,并具有显著的社会效益.

  • 水泥土无侧向抗压强度试验分析与研究

    通过水泥土室内试验,研究了水泥的掺入量对土的最优含水率及最大干密度的影响,以及对水泥土无侧限抗压强度的影响.结果表明,水泥掺入量不同的水泥土的最优含水率和最大干密度相差不大,水泥土的强度随着水泥掺入量增加而增大.
